Prior Authorization Simplification - H.R. 3514/S. 1816 - Improving Seniors Timely Access to Care Act Establish an electronic prior authorization process for MA plans including a standardization for transactions and clinical attachments. Increase transparency around MA prior authorization requirements and its use. Clarify CMS authority to establish timeframes for e-PA requests including expedited determinations, real-time decisions for routinely approved items and services, and other PA requests. Expand beneficiary protections to improve enrollee experiences and outcomes. Require HHS and other agencies to report to Congress on program integrity efforts and other ways to further improve the e-PA process.
